Overall Meaning

The Classics IV And Dennis Yost's song Spooky is about a man who is in love with a mysterious and unpredictable woman. He tries to make plans with her but she keeps him guessing by saying no initially, but then ultimately agreeing. The man is constantly unsure of where he stands with her, as her actions and thoughts are erratic and unpredictable. Despite these challenges, he still loves her because he finds her intriguing and fascinating. The lyrics describe her as a spooky little girl who is reminiscent of a ghost who haunts his dreams. He proposes to her on Halloween, which is fitting given the eerie nature of their relationship.


The song has a catchy tune that draws you in and makes you want to sing along. The lyrics are relatable to anyone who has been in a relationship with someone they find mysterious or unpredictable. The use of the word "spooky" adds a playful and whimsical element to the song, which keeps it from becoming too serious or heavy.
